diff options
Diffstat (limited to 'src/stateless/cp')
-rw-r--r-- | src/stateless/cp/trex_stateless.cpp | 1 | ||||
-rw-r--r-- | src/stateless/cp/trex_streams_compiler.cpp | 3 |
2 files changed, 3 insertions, 1 deletions
diff --git a/src/stateless/cp/trex_stateless.cpp b/src/stateless/cp/trex_stateless.cpp index 9e24802b..9df57a50 100644 --- a/src/stateless/cp/trex_stateless.cpp +++ b/src/stateless/cp/trex_stateless.cpp @@ -132,6 +132,7 @@ TrexStateless::encode_stats(Json::Value &global) { api->get_global_stats(stats); global["cpu_util"] = stats.m_stats.m_cpu_util; + global["rx_cpu_util"] = stats.m_stats.m_rx_cpu_util; global["tx_bps"] = stats.m_stats.m_tx_bps; global["rx_bps"] = stats.m_stats.m_rx_bps; diff --git a/src/stateless/cp/trex_streams_compiler.cpp b/src/stateless/cp/trex_streams_compiler.cpp index be5002da..563236c2 100644 --- a/src/stateless/cp/trex_streams_compiler.cpp +++ b/src/stateless/cp/trex_streams_compiler.cpp @@ -477,7 +477,8 @@ TrexStreamsCompiler::compile_stream(TrexStream *stream, TrexStream *fixed_rx_flow_stat_stream = stream->clone(true); - get_stateless_obj()->m_rx_flow_stat.start_stream(fixed_rx_flow_stat_stream, fixed_rx_flow_stat_stream->m_rx_check.m_hw_id); //???? check for errors + // not checking for errors. We assume that if add_stream succeeded, start_stream will too. + get_stateless_obj()->m_rx_flow_stat.start_stream(fixed_rx_flow_stat_stream, fixed_rx_flow_stat_stream->m_rx_check.m_hw_id); /* can this stream be split to many cores ? */ if (!stream->is_splitable(dp_core_count)) { |